Me, over the radio: Hey folks, the driver is here for a hotshot, they are backing into Door 9, please load them up, paperwork is at the dispatch window.
Evening floor supervisor, immediately after: Do they have a van or a deck? 'Cause they are picking up skids of drums.
A the office mate: *mad cackling* Oh. My. God! *more cackling*
Me: *obvious disbelief* They have a van. They are backing into Door 9.
For the uninitiated, you NEVER load a deck from dock level. Ever. Way too easy to drive off the edge of the deck.
